At our practice, we are pleased to offer a convenient in-house Minor Surgery Clinic held once a month.
Instead of waiting for a hospital outpatient appointment, many minor skin procedures and joint treatments can be carried out quickly and safely right here at the surgery by our specially trained clinical team.
๐ What We Can Treat
Our monthly minor surgery clinic is equipped to handle a variety of small procedures under local anaesthetic, including:

๐งผ Cyst Removal: Removal of small, benign (non-cancerous) fluid-filled sacs under the skin.

๐ท๏ธ Skin Tags & Warts: Removing uncomfortable or catching skin tags, warts, or other benign skin growths.

๐งด Excisions of Lipomas: Removal of small, non-cancerous fatty lumps beneath the skin.
โ How to Book an Appointment
Because minor surgery requires a clinical assessment to ensure it is safe and appropriate for your condition, you cannot self-refer directly into this clinic.
1. ๐ฉบ Step 1: Initial Assessment: Book a routine appointment to see a GP, or submit a request with a photo of the area using our Accurx Online Triage tool.
2.๐ Step 2: Clinical Review: The doctor will assess the lump, bump, or skintag. If it is suitable for our monthly clinic, they will explain the procedure, answer your questions, and gain your verbal consent.

Once approved, our admin team will contact you to book you into our next available monthly minor surgery slot.

โ ๏ธ Please Note: > We cannot perform cosmetic procedures on the NHS. Minor surgery is only available for lumps, bumps, or joint issues that are causing physical pain, restriction, or regular infection.
